Graphics Communication Technician

New Haven Unified School District

Class Title:

Graphics Communication Technician

PRIMARY FUNCTION

  • Under supervision, to assist in the overall production scheduling of a printing facility
  • To operate the production equipment available at said facility
  • To assist in the coordination of work of personnel assigned
  • And to do related work as required consistent with job description.

ORGANIZATIONAL RELATIONSHIPS

Directly responsible to designated administrators.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S

  • Operates duplicating, collating, binding, photolithographic and plate-making equipment
  • Trains and coordinates the work of subordinates in the operation of said equipment
  • Oversees duplicating machine operations including methods used in making masters, set ups, mixing of solutions, cleaning, adjustment, and minor repair of equipment
  • Maintains supply inventories, records of operation, calculates billing for completed work
  • Operates equipment as production requires.
  • Overtime work is part of the job responsibility.
